Important Considerations and Licensing
Before integrating any asset into your workflow, understanding the usage rights is non-negotiable. The licensing for this specific Canva mockup kit is designed to protect the creator while empowering the user. You have full permission to use the final designs—meaning the mockups with your art inserted—to promote your business. This covers digital marketing, printed brochures, and website banners.
However, the boundaries are clear to maintain the integrity of the asset. You may not sell or distribute the template itself to third parties. This is standard practice in the design world; you are buying a license to use the tool, not to resell the tool. Similarly, you cannot use these specific templates to create other templates for commercial resale. This distinction is vital for maintaining a fair marketplace for creative fonts and design assets.
